Parous

/ˈpɛə̯ɹəs/ adj

adj ·Rare ·Advanced level

Definitions

Adjective
  1. 1
    Having given birth. not-comparable

    "Further changes in neurochemistry in pregnant/parous females (e.g., changes in neuropeptides, opioids, neurotransmitters, etc.; Bridges, Felicio, Pellerin, Stuer, & Mann 1993 ; Keverne & Kendrick, 1990 ; Kinsley & Bridges, 1988 ), may render neurons from a pregnant or lactating female substantially different in form and function than those taken from NULL females."

Etymology

Ultimately from Latin pariō (“I give birth”).
